Publisher's summary

A kidnapping, a ransom, and a promise of blood.

Kidnapped while journeying with her maid, Morven, Louise McGregor finds herself the prisoner of the charming rogue Colin McKay. As she waits for her father to answer Colin’s demand for ransom, she begins to see there is more to her captor than meets the eye. The threat of war looms between the McGregors and the Ross clan, but will Louise’s father get to her in time, or will Colin sell her to the highest bidder?

Worse still, when the Ross clan show up in force, it may not be for the reasons she expected. Little does she know Hamish Ross - son of the laird of the Ross clan - has revenge on his mind when it comes to Colin McKay.

As things heat up and swords are drawn, will Colin get out with his life intact? Worse still, will he finally have worn Louise down with his charms?

Good Clean Story!

Highland Ransom is the first book in a new series by Lindsey Logan. The story is set in medieval Scotland and follows Collin who has no family and has been forced into committing crimes, such as theft and robbery, in order to survive. His life leads him to cross paths with Louise who is the daughter of a Laird. Collin thinks he will be set for life when he sees the opportunity to kidnap Louise and ransom her back to her father.

What’s in the story?
❤️Sex: None, only a couple of kisses. Sexual assault is discussed, but in a very veiled manner.
🗡Violence: Fighting between men with knives. A female character is knocked out by a man with a rock and left for dead.
🤬Profanity: None.
🍺💊🚬Alcohol/Drugs/Smoking: Characters drink whiskey and ale.

I love the dual narration. Andrew McDermott and Jenn McGuirk do a great job! Looking forward to hearing more from them. If you’re looking for a clean, smut-free story that is appropriate for readers 14 and up, this is a good choice. It seems to be a good start to this new series. 📚

A charming medieval highland romance

Highland Ransom by Lindsey Logan - a charming enemies to lovers medieval highland romance
Great fun. An opportunistic kidnapping of Louise MacGregor, the Laird's daughter, brings both danger and delight to Colin McKay, a rogue living in the forest. Colin has to negotiate a ransom, his captive's grasp of reality and avoid loosing his head and his heart. I loved this feisty but spoilt heroine and her awakening to the sordid reality of what goes on outside the castle walls. This is a sweet, clean romance. To be savoured.

The dual narration by Andrew McDermott and Jenn McGuirk bring this delightful romance to life. I love the authentic Scottish accents. Andrew McDermott is one of my favourite narrators and this is another great listen. Highly recommended.
